Readability and Versatility
While Victorian is a beautiful display font, it's important to consider readability, especially for smaller text and mobile screens. For longer text or body copy, I recommend pairing Victorian with a clean sans serif font, such as Helvetica or Arial. This combination ensures that your message is clear and easy to read, while still maintaining the elegant and refined look of Victorian.
For example, on our product descriptions and ingredient lists, I used a clean sans serif font for the details, while keeping Victorian for the titles and headings. This approach balanced the aesthetic appeal with practical readability, making the information accessible and engaging for our customers.
Font Pairing and Design Tips
To create a well-rounded and visually appealing design, consider these font pairing ideas:
- Clean Sans Serif: Pair Victorian with a clean and modern sans serif font for a contemporary yet elegant look. This combination works well for both digital and print materials.
- Elegant Serif: For a more traditional and classic feel, pair Victorian with an elegant serif font. This can be particularly effective for editorial design, such as menus or brochures.
- Handwritten Font: Adding a handwritten font alongside Victorian can create a personal and authentic touch. This is ideal for thank-you cards, personal notes, or custom messages.
